Food grade aloe vera gel : skin, in dc, scalp mixture
Elucence mb: mix sometimes in dc, leave in/daily moisturizer both diluted in a spray bottle.
oils: prepoo, dc, roller set, skin
any poo I don't like= shaving gel, additive for footbath
avocado butter: skin, hair
biosilk serum: body oil (my hair hated it and I refuse to waste the big bottle)

Most moisturizing conditioners can be used on wet or dry hair. Lot's of stuff out of the kitchen, EVOO, eggs, mayo, baking soda, ACV, dish detergent. Shea butter, aloe, peppermint oil, jojoba oil, etc. Most oils. I have used my facial moisturizer on the ends of my hair.
